In the ever-evolving field of clean energy, the Certificate in Nanomaterials: Nanomaterials for Solar Cells offers a unique blend of nanotechnology and solar energy, opening up diverse career paths. Here are some of the most relevant roles in the UK market: 1. **Nanomaterials Scientist**: Specialise in designing, synthesising, and characterising nanomaterials for various applications, particularly in solar cells. 2. **Solar Cell Engineer**: Focus on the design, development, and optimisation of solar cell devices, harnessing the potential of nanomaterials for enhanced efficiency. 3. **Materials Scientist**: Work with a broad range of materials, including nanomaterials, to develop innovative solutions for various industries, including clean energy. 4. **Nanotechnology Engineer**: Apply engineering principles to design, develop, and scale up nanotechnology-based products and processes for solar cell manufacturing and other industries.
